Gem [已解决] font-awesome-sass 使用后,页面的图标无法显示,控制台报找不到字体文件 404

xnchen · 2018年04月22日 · 最后由 xnchen 回复于 2018年08月29日 · 2484 次阅读

font-awesome-sass Gem 使用后,页面的图标无法显示,控制台报找不到字体文件 404,可是相对于路径下的字体文件是存在的 还有一个问题

是不是用了这个 gem 之后本地不需要 fontawesome.css 等文件,以及字体文件, 我目前是有字体文件,没有 css 文件

更加奇怪的是为什么还会报路由问题,字体文件竟然报了资源问题

或者说不使用这个 gem,怎么将 font-awesome 的文件放入项目中,并且在每个 XXX.html.erb 文件中引用呢? 一般是不是只需要应用 fonts 字体文件资源,以及 less/scss/css 三种资源中的一种即可,萌新求贴

参照官方流程做

https://github.com/FortAwesome/font-awesome-sass

我看了它的实现,你按 REDAME 的流程做不会有问题的

你不需要将字体或 css 文件手动放 app/assets 目录

huacnlee 回复

是的,我以为文件结尾.css 或者.sass 就可以,可是教程貌似是.css.sass 结尾,所以改成这样就 OK 了,谢谢

huacnlee 关闭了讨论。 08月30日 10:07
需要 登录 后方可回复, 如果你还没有账号请 注册新账号